EXHIBITION BY ARTIST CHIA YU CHIAN

The exhibition by Artist Chia Yu Chian showed a very interesting angle into the lives of people living in Malaysia at that time. He shows the lives of everyday people doing everyday things and, in the process, captures the other aspects that we never pay attention.

Fig 1.1 Chia's Restaurant painting
For example, In the Painting shown in Figure 1.1 Chia portrays a scene outside a Restaurant. We see in the painting things like cars, uniformed chauffeurs. A spectacle of people looking back to see what was happening behind them and beggars walking by unnoticed. In this image we see an everyday scenario. However, in this painting Yu Chian shows us the economic disparity between the rich and the poor, the consequences of rapid urbanism and Materialism.


Fig 1.2 Urban Street painting
We can also see Perspective in most of Yu Chian’s work which is a very important concept we learned at our Design Principle Lectures. (Figure1.2)

Fig 1.3 Technique
Yu Chians uses a similar technique for almost all his paintings (Figure 1.3). His technique of Painting forms interesting Textures on his paintings. These textures add contrast to his paintings and enhances vibrance of the colors. 

Fig 1.4 Sketch
The exhibition also displayed sketched that was done by the artist. (Figure 1.4). These pieces showed how the artist generated his ideas. Yu Chian used precise lines to create these sketches.


PHOTOGRAPHY EXHIBITION

Fig 2.1


The Photography exhibit showcased work by 7 different artists. The first things I noticed in the photographs were the strong contrasts with shadows and lights. (Figure 2.2). Most of the images were B/W, because of this some of the elements in the photographs appeared as silhouettes creating a very strong outcome.
The photographs all showed very strong emotions and they all had a message behind them. Some even showing the traditions of Thailand.
